What We Do in the Shadows
What We Do in the Shadows

What We Do in the Shadows

Some interviews with some vampires

Genres

ComedyHorror

OverView

Vampire housemates try to cope with the complexities of modern life and show a newly turned hipster some of the perks of being undead.
